怎样解决Java Web项目更改项目名后报错以及不能找到web路径问题

       怎样解决Java Web项目更改项目名后报错以及不能找到web路径问题



          一个java项目怎么改项目名字,用F2改了后,但是web项目用网页运行时还要输入原来的项目名字才能运行项目,不然报404错误,我现在要用改了后的名字登录网页应该怎么该便项目的路径,我应该怎么改名字


        这里给大家说一下项目名字是可以改成【中文的】(但是,为了提高自己英语水平可以不改大笑


步骤如下

       1.  在项目改名后,还得在如下地方改:我用的是MyEclipse9
**项目上右击鼠标-->Properties-->MyEclipse-->Web-->Content Root-->Web content-root-->改成你想要的项目名 即可  




2.



       注意:   你部署过去的是webroot中的内容,也就是对应这个root的名称, 而不是你的项目名称, 项目名称改了跟这个root一点关系都没有


3.有时候会发现还是不行,不要急,这是myeclipse低版本的问题,由于有时候虽然自己已近改了,可是项目中的一个
.mymetadata文件没有改变。所有这时候自己去检查一下,对应项目下的这个文件是否没
有改过来。

步骤:

         更改项目中的.mymetadata文件,用记事本打开,把context-root="/新名字"    这也是一定要与上面自己在myeclipse中修改过的【web  路径一致     最后后重启MyEclipse ,重新部署下工程就行。





-----------------------------------------------------------------------------

web发布名称在Myeclipse中修改:项目→properties→myeclipse→web→web context-root修改。
\这种效果在没有工具的情况下(只有项目文件夹),如何修改web项目的发布名?

把你的 web 项目的源文件夹打包成一个 zip 包,然后改名成 jar 后缀,这个文件名叫什么,那么它放到 tomcat 这种服务器上就是什么 context root。

比如,这样一个 web 项目,我们把 WebContent 文件夹打包成 hello.zip,然后改名成 hello.jar 复制到 tomcat 的 webapps 目录下,它就是 /hello 啦。
G:.

├─.settings
├─src
│  └─net
│      └─vicp
│          └─atreides
└─WebContent
    ├─META-INF
    └─WEB-INF
        ├─classes
        │  └─net
        │      └─vicp
        │          └─atreides
        └─lib
  • 2
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值